If music is not enough for you, you could simply add a lightshow. While trying to decorate and personalize my turntable I came up with this idea. Take a look at the video to see how it works. http://youtu.be/zpftUBy3FbQ Instructions Everything is written in OpenSCAD and documented. (In total more than 1000 lines of code) Just download the code and modify. (Bring some time, rendering can take very long.) All parts are printable without support material in an area by 10x10cm. To construct your own lighteffectswheel, you have the choice between several components. groundplaneWithAxis: As the name says, this is necessary to print. chaserone: A wheel with one gap, which generates flashing lights. chaserstrobo: A wheel with three gaps, which generates a strobo effect. chasercolored: A wheel with no holes, but thin walls. This should be printed in white. Insert a paperstripe as you can see in the video to generate coloreffects. cap1: the cap to close the wheel. This one has extra holes for a connector. cap2: the cap to close the wheel. This one has no holes for connectors, but a chamfer for the hole in the middle. Use this one if you have to much friction with cap1. connectros: may not necessary. Use the connectors, if your cap doesn´t stay in place. crossedwheels: use them to adjust the height and put one on top to stabelize the chaserwheel. They are 2/3/4/5/10 mm high. planetary_assembled: take a look at it ;) planetary_printable: parts for the planetary wheel with the ghosts. Getting Started: 1) Build your own Stroboeffect: print groundplaneWithAxis, chaserstrobo, cap1, crosses. push the cap into chaserstrobo, so that the teeth are below. Then follow the steps shown in the video. Use the "crossed-wheels" to adjust the height. 2) Build your own Coloreffect: print groundplaneWithAxis (if not already printed), chasercolored, cap1, crosses (if not already printed) take a piece of paper and cut a paperstripe of ~250x25mm. use highlighters and paint your effect. put the stripe into the wheel. 3) Build a wheel with rotating ghosts: print groundplaneWithAxis (if not already printed), chaser*, cap2 (may not necessary), crosses (if not already printed), planetary_printable (in high quality) glue the planetary wheel on top of the chaser.
